The past several years for Texas Teachers has been quite the journey with new TEKS, a curriculum adoption, and more! Thankfully, the Texas Education Agency's (TEA) latest addition helps to take away a lot of confusion.

 

TEKS, or the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ills are the guiding standards for all Texas educators. For those caught unaware, there has been a large number of changes, revisions, and movement of TEKS within the field of science education. This has caused a large-scale level of confusion for educators unsure of what they are required to teach or no longer responsible for.

 

Enter TEA's TEKS Guide! This new resource might have flown under your radar unless you had someone actively direct you to it or you are an avid TEKS enthusiast. This resource, while still new, allows you to navigate standards by grade level, discipline, and even search for key terms/words.

 

 

Worth noting is that this is still in BETA, so do not expect it to be perfect - what really is these days. TEA encourages feedback, and the more feedback the better. Check it out today!
